Miscellaneous’ 1-0 win against Kazungula Young Fighters over the weekend moved them to an unassailable of 44 points with three games left in their successful  campaign.

Miscellaneous coach, Russia Chaba perceptively attributed their win to better organisation and support from both the fans and management.

“We were also wise in the market. When we lost key players such as Segolame Boy after we were relegated, we brought experienced players like midfielder Samuel Phiri, who has played Premier League football.

“We also have the likes of striker, Chakhova Moenga who also campaigned in the Premier League, which greatly helped us win automatic promotion,” he said.

He said competition was not fierce in the First Division, which made their path easier.

Chaba said that the team has already begun preparing for life in the Premier League.

“Our intention is to sign a quality central defender, midfielders and two reputable strikers. I believe this is what the team needs to sustain its stay in the league,” he told Mmegi Sport yesterday.

Meanwhile, despite their 1-1 draw over the weekend against Amakhosi, Mahalapye Hotspurs are still in contention to finish second, which is a play-off spot. Hotspurs are just two points above Green Lovers on 32 points.

TAFIC, that have won five matches in a row, still have a chance to make it to the play-offs, should Hotspurs and Lovers continue their inconsistence. TAFIC have 31 points with three games left to wrap up the season.
